AceShowbiz - Good friends Lady GaGa and Elton John have a collaborative track together. Although John previously said their hectic schedule made it difficult for them to hook up in the studio, the scheduling conflicts apparently have been sorted out.
According to Entertainment Weekly, the two singers who joined forces at 2010 Grammys will reunite in a charming pop track called "Hello, Hello". It will serve as a soundtrack for upcoming Disney animated film "Gnomeo and Juliet" which is co-produced by John.
The song will be played in the movie when the two lead characters, lawn ornaments named Gnomeo (voiced by James McAvoy) and Juliet (tackled by Emily Blunt), meet for the first time. Also supported by Jason Statham and Patrick Stewart, the film will hit theaters on February 11, 2011. As for the song, it is most likely to arrive sooner than the movie.
